Transaction dc6359323b2aacb0ae6bd54e80f79512e8e48003cc53c79c87a36c09adcec992

2 Input
1 Outputs
  • dc6359323b2aacb0ae6bd54e80f79512e8e48003cc53c79c87a36c09adcec992:0
  • value  11956663
    address  1C7WK1FDm5gYC2ZJGpwcJ9BoBERpqX26i5